Transaction eeb70eaaf60a9f0dbbb56fcbdfc5c54f18acb99bf7f68ff21733a18f02819716

1 Input
2 Outputs
  • eeb70eaaf60a9f0dbbb56fcbdfc5c54f18acb99bf7f68ff21733a18f02819716:0
  • value  213689
    address  178VSFs59tg2G36dmJWHeRmTJ8iB43aC3r
  • eeb70eaaf60a9f0dbbb56fcbdfc5c54f18acb99bf7f68ff21733a18f02819716:1
  • value  623228989
    address  34ZzLyeCs7pD2ANk9mwEeXVpgpaW6EbA4v